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Hairy Yellow-shouldered Bat | New Guinean Quoll |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(cordados) | Chordata (cordados) |
| Class same | Mammalia (mamíferos) | Mammalia (mamíferos) |
| Order | Chiroptera (Bats) | Dasyuromorphia (Dasyuromorphia) |
| Family | Phyllostomidae | Dasyuridae |
| Genus | Sturnira | Dasyurus |
| Species | Sturnira erythromos | Dasyurus albopunctatus |
Evolutionary Relationship
Hairy Yellow-shouldered Bat and New Guinean Quoll share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(mamíferos)
